Speaking at an event in Abuja on Thursday, July 11, 2024 the EFCC boss said: “Aside t£rrorism, corr¥ption ranks as the next deadliest affliction of humanity in every region of the world. In view of the danger and thr£ to our existence which corruption represents, it is imperative that individuals, communities, corporate bodies and indeed the whole world join hands together to tackle it frontally.
One way of doing this is through the whistle-blowing initiative. We cannot win the war against corruption through lip service, emotional outburst or mere mob campaigns.
